Microsoft Outlook
Outlook lets you bring all your email accounts and calendars in one convenient spot. Whether it’s staying on top of your inbox or scheduling the next big thing, we make it easy to be your most productive, organised and connected self.
Here’s what you’ll love about Outlook for iOS:
– Focus on the right things with our smart inbox – we help you sort between messages you need to act on straight away and everything else.
– Swipe to quickly schedule, delete and archive messages.
– Share your meeting availability with just a tap and easily find times to meet with others.
– Find everything you’re looking for, including files, contacts, and your forthcoming trips.
– View and attach any file from your email, OneDrive, Dropbox, and more, without having to download them to your phone.
– Open Word, Excel, or PowerPoint attachments to edit them directly in the corresponding app and attach them back to an email.
– Recap extra-long email threads in an instant with Summarise with Copilot*
– Type a few words to have Copilot* jump-start your writing with an outline or draft
– Before sending off your email, use Coaching with Copilot* to get tips and suggestions that help improve the overall tone, sentiment, and clarity
*Microsoft 365 Personal/Family subscription or business account enabled with Copilot required to use Copilot features
—
Outlook for iOS works with Microsoft Exchange, Office 365, Outlook.com (including Hotmail and MSN), Gmail, Yahoo Email, and iCloud.

Permissions Observations
DETECTEDPermissions defined by Apple and Google as dangerous have been observed.
Observed During Analysis
- The app needs access to Bluetooth.
- The app is requesting the ability to connect to Bluetooth peripherals.
- + 10 more
- The app is requesting access to the device’s camera.
- The app is requesting access to the user’s contacts.
- The app is requesting the ability to authenticate with Face ID.
- The app is requesting access to the user’s location information at all times.
- The app is requesting access to the user’s location information while the app is running in the foreground.
- The app is requesting access to the device’s microphone.
- The app is requesting add-only access to the user’s photo library.
- The app is requesting access to the user’s photo library.
- The app is requesting to send user data to Apple’s speech recognition servers.
- App is requesting permission to use data for tracking the user or the device.

Why Permissions Matter
If not managed properly, dangerous permissions can permit malicious access to sensitive data, and device features.

Why Privacy Declarations Matter
Declarations matter because they provide transparency on how apps collect and use sensitive data. iOS requires Privacy Manifest declarations, while Android requires Data Safety disclosures and manifest permissions.
